The Royal Swedish Academy of Sciences has announced the 2025 Sveriges Riksbank Prize in Economic Sciences, i.e. the Nobel Prize in Economics, in memory of Alfred Nobel. This year the award is given to Joel Mokyr, Philippe Aghion and Peter Howitt “for explaining innovation-driven economic growth”. Half of the prize will be awarded jointly to Mokyr “for identifying the necessary conditions for sustainable development through technological progress” and the remaining half to Aghion and Howitt “for the theory of sustainable development through creative destruction”.

Last year’s prize was awarded to three economists – Daron Acemoglu, Simon Johnson and James A. Robinson was given. He studied why some countries are rich and others are poor. He showed in his research that more free, open societies are more likely to prosper.

The Nobel Prize in Economics is formally known as the Bank of Sweden Prize in Economic Sciences in Memory of Alfred Nobel. The central bank established it in 1968 in memory of 19th century Swedish businessman and chemist Nobel.

Nobel invented dynamite and established five Nobel Prizes. Since then, the award has been presented 56 times to a total of 96 winners. Till now, only three women have been named among the Nobel winners in economics. Some experts argue that the Nobel Prize in Economics is not technically a Nobel Prize, but it is always given on December 10 along with other awards. This date is the anniversary of Nobel’s death in 1896. Earlier last week, Nobel Prizes were announced in the fields of medicine, physics, chemistry, literature and peace.
